REASONS FOR JUDGMENT ON ORDER AS TO COSTS
1 In delivering judgment in these matters I proposed to make no order as to costs on the basis that the applicants and the Australian Securities and Investments Commission (ASIC) had each been partially successful in the proceedings. Counsel for ASIC however raised the possibility that a different order should be made in relation to the costs of the proceedings and I allowed seven days for submissions as to costs to be filed.
2 The solicitors for the applicants and Mr Benter for the Perth office of ASIC have now written to the Court indicating that they are agreed there should be no order as to the costs of the two applications. I will order accordingly.
